Hiring a web designer to build a professional website for your new start-up may not be necessary nor your wisest option. If funds are in short supply but you have some spare time and are reasonably "computer savvy", a "Do-it-yourself" website may be your best bet - especially if you want to "test the waters" with your new idea before grabbing your cheque book and diving head first into the deep end.

Need an e-Commerce website to sell your products online?
If you're wading into the online marketplace with your new product(s) and are looking for a simple, inexpensive solution to get started, Shopify.com is likely your best bet. Shopify will host your online shopping website and has a wide range of design options and sales tools along with 24/7 support to get your online store launched.
"I need something ridiculously easy because I'm not the most computer savvy person in the world"
A D-I-Y website building platform called Weebly.com is designed to be really simple for even the most "technically challenged" users to get up and running with minimal head scratching and desk pounding.
